About This Tool

Purpose & User Intent: This tool solves the need to record GNOME desktop sessions for tutorials, bug reports, demos, and support workflows. Target users include IT staff, developers, technical writers, and educators documenting Linux software usage. When: during software demos or issue reproduction.
Core Logic & Features: The recording engine supports full-screen, window, and region captures, with optional microphone, system audio, and webcam overlays. Outputs include MP4, WebM, or GIF, with adjustable frame rate and quality. Required features ensure accurate capture and stable encoding; optional features include hotkeys, presets, and CLI automation for scripted workflows.
Inputs & Outputs: Inputs include capture_mode (full|window|region), region_coords, fps, output_format, output_quality, audio_source (none|mic|system), webcam_device, duration_seconds, and output_path. Outputs provide a recorded_file_path, duration, and file_size in bytes, using the requested format and quality. Validation ensures required inputs are present and compatible with the running GNOME session.
Algorithms & Calculations: Encoding uses target bitrate and frame rate to estimate file size: size ≈ duration × bitrate. When system audio is selected, sample rate and channel count are matched to the input devices. Edge cases adjust for variable frame rate and dynamic scene complexity to avoid stutters. Industry/Region & Localization: Aligns with Linux desktop conventions, uses SI units, and outputs widely compatible formats (MP4/WebM). Compatibility notes cover Wayland vs X11 and regional date/time formatting in metadata if present. Assumptions & Exclusions: Not an editor; no streaming; not a live collaboration tool; does not capture encrypted content without permission; not designed for remote sessions.

What platforms and environments are supported?
It targets GNOME on Linux systems with common display servers. Compatibility varies by Wayland or X11; some Wayland setups require permissions or compositor support for recording audio and video, and not all extensions are available in every distro.
Which formats are supported for export?
Exports include MP4 and WebM for video, and GIF as a low-framerate option. Quality and bitrate options allow balancing file size and fidelity for tutorials, bug reports, or demos.
Can I record system audio and microphone simultaneously?
Yes. You can mix microphone input with system audio or choose one source only. Proper permissions are required by the GNOME session and the audio subsystem to capture each channel.
Is scripting or automation supported?
A CLI interface is available for scripted recording tasks, preset configurations, and batch captures. This supports reproducible demos and automated documentation workflows but excludes real-time editing.
